ORDER

The instant writ petition has been filed by a Correspondent of a minority institution challenging the order passed by the third respondent on 04.10.2024.

2. The petitioner management has promoted Mrs.A.Mebila, from the post of Secondary Grade Teacher to the post of Primary School 2/6

Headmistress on 06.06.2024 with effect from 10.06.2024. The relieving order of the petitioner was forwarded to the authorities for their approval. Under the impugned order, the third respondent has refused to approve the relieving order primarily on the ground that the promotee has not passed TET examination. This order is put to challenge in the present writ petition.

3. According to the learned counsel for the writ petitioner, the petitioner institution being a minority institution, it is not mandatory for the appointee to pass TET either for appointment or for promotion.

4. Per contra, learned Additional Government Pleader appearing for the respondent herein has contended that for being promoted as a Primary School Headmistress, a pass in TET is a required qualification.

5. Heard the submissions on either side and perused the materials on record.

6. The Hon'ble Division Bench of our High Court in a judgment reported in 2023 (3) LW 112 (The Director of School Education, D.P.I. Campus, College Road, Chennai -06 and two others Vs. Velayutham 3/6

and another) in paragraph No. 74(c) has categorically held that pass in TET examination is not mandatory for being appointed as teacher in a Minority Institution.

7. Admittedly, the petitioner institution is a minority institution. Therefore, the authorities cannot reject the approval of relieving the writ petitioner on the ground that the promotee has not pass passed TET examination.

8. In view of the above said deliberations, the order impugned in this writ petition is set aside and the third respondent is directed to approve the relieving order of the writ petitioner and pass orders within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
